Qfsm Icon

Qfsm

A graphical Finite State Machine (FSM) designer.

5.0 Stars (5)
99 Downloads (This Week)
Last Update:
Download qfsm-0.54.0-Source.tar.bz2
Browse All Files
BSD Windows Linux

Screenshots

Description

A graphical tool for designing finite state machines and exporting them to Hardware Description Languages, such as VHDL, AHDL, Verilog, or Ragel/SMC files for C, C++, Objective-C, Java, Python, PHP, Perl, Lua code generation.

Qfsm Web Site

Features

  • Drawing, editing and printing of diagrams
  • Binary, ASCII and "free text" condition codes
  • Integrity check
  • Interactive simulation
  • HDL export in the file formats: AHDL, VHDL, Verilog HDL, KISS
  • Creation of VHDL test code
  • EPS, SVG, PNG diagram export
  • State table export in Latex, HTML and plain text format
  • State Machine Compiler (SMC) export
  • Ragel file export
  • Other export formats: SCXML, vvvv Automata code

KEEP ME UPDATED

User Ratings

★★★★★
★★★★
★★★
★★
5
0
0
0
0
ease 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
features 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
design 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
support 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 0 / 5
Write a Review

User Reviews

  • josearmstrong
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Qfsm works perfectly.

    Posted 06/10/2013
  • akaleshin
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Pretty good. Really easy to use!

    Posted 02/14/2013
  • lunarider
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Not a bad, but not the best. Just ok.

    Posted 11/03/2012
  • raysump
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    Very nice app.

    Posted 10/19/2012
  • ettlmartin
    1 of 5 2 of 5 3 of 5 4 of 5 5 of 5

    great tool!

    Posted 01/21/2011
Read more reviews

Additional Project Details

Languages

French, English, German, Russian

Intended Audience

Science/Research, Developers, End Users/Desktop

User Interface

X Window System (X11), Win32 (MS Windows), Qt

Programming Language

C++

Registered

2001-10-21
Screenshots can attract more users to your project.
Features can attract more users to your project.